Recently been automatically transferred to TalkTalk from Shell Energy in what I was told would be a "seamless transfer" and that I wouldn't have to do anything. A few weeks after the transfer, I get an accusatory email saying that as I haven't paid the monthly direct debit, I've been charged an additional £12.50! Several hours later I get a text, saying that it was due to a technical issue and that the additional charge would not be implemented. There was a sort of apology for the inconvenience but it was more than that, it was an outright accusation of non-payment. Any other ex-Shell customers get this? I still don't know what's going on. If you search this forum and look at the pinned post you will see this happened to a number of customers.
You won't be charged the £12.50
An unfortunate set of circumstances meant your account was transferred before the direct debit was fully in place. Because of this it triggered the email you received.
